Ingredients You’ll Need

  • 8 ounces pasta – I recommend using fettuccine or penne for the best texture.
  • 1 pound chicken breast – boneless and skinless, provides lean protein.
  • 3 tablespoons honey – adds a natural sweetness that balances the heat.
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per – fresh ground for the best flavor, enhancing the dish’s spiciness.
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il – for sautéing the chicken and adding richness.
  • 4 cloves garlic – minced, it infuses the dish with aromatic notes.
  • 1 cup chicken broth – adds depth and moisture to the sauce.
  • 1 cup heavy cream – for a rich, creamy texture that clings to the pasta.
  • Salt to taste – essential for enhancing all the flavors.
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ley – for garnish and fresh flavor.

How to Make Honey Pepper Chicken Pasta Recipe

Step 1: Cook the Pasta

Begin by bringing a large pot of salted water to a boil. Add the pasta and cook according to package instructions until al dente. Once done, drain the pasta, reserving about half a cup of the pasta water for later use.

Step 2: Prepare the Chicken

While the pasta cooks, pat the chicken breasts dry with a paper towel. Season both sides generously with salt and black pepper. In a skillet, heat the olive oil over medium-high heat. Add the chicken to the skillet, cooking for about 5-7 minutes on each side, or until golden brown and cooked through. Remove from the skillet and let it rest.

Step 3: Make the Sauce

In the same skillet, lower the heat to medium and add the minced garlic. Sauté for about 30 seconds until fragrant, being careful not to burn it. Pour in the chicken broth and scrape any browned bits from the bottom of the skillet, as this adds flavor to the sauce. Allow the broth to simmer for a few minutes.

Step 4: Combine Honey and Cream

Add the honey and heavy cream to the skillet, stirring well to combine. Let this mixture simmer for about 5 minutes, allowing it to thicken slightly. Adjust seasoning with salt and additional black pepper if desired.

Step 5: Toss Everything Together

Slice the cooked chicken into strips and return it to the skillet. Add the drained pasta, tossing everything together to coat the pasta and chicken in the creamy sauce. If the sauce is too thick, add a little reserved pasta water to achieve the desired consistency.

Step 6: Garnish and Serve

Finally, sprinkle the chopped fresh parsley over the dish before serving. This not only adds a pop of color but also a burst of freshness that complements the dish beautifully.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Overcooking the pasta can lead to a mushy texture; always aim for al dente.
  • Skipping the resting time for the chicken can make it tough; let it sit before slicing.
  • Using pre-minced garlic might result in a less fragrant dish than fresh garlic.
  • Not adjusting the seasoning at the end can lead to a bland dish; always taste before serving.

How to Store & Reheat

Storing

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. If you plan to store it longer, consider freezing it in a freezer-safe container for up to a month.

Reheating

To reheat, place the pasta in a skillet over medium heat, adding a splash of chicken broth or reserved pasta water to loosen the sauce. Stir occasionally until heated through. Alternatively, you can microwave it in short intervals, stirring in between to ensure even heating.

Honey Pepper Chicken Pasta Recipe

Honey Pepper Chicken Pasta Recipe

This Honey Pepper Chicken Pasta is the ultimate comfort dish — tender chicken bites tossed in a sweet, spicy, and creamy Parmesan sauce over perfectly cooked penne. It’s ready in just 30 minutes and easily customizable for your taste or dietary needs.

Prep Time
10 mins

Cook Time
20 mins

Total Time
30 mins

Servings
4 servings

Ingredients You’ll Need

  • 12 oz penne pasta
  • 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ken breasts (bite-sized)
  • Salt and black pepper, to taste
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tbsp butter
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1/4 cup honey
  • 1 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1/2 tsp crushed red pepper flakes (adjust to taste)
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. Step 1
    Cook pasta until al dente, drain, and set aside.
  2. Step 2
    Season chicken with salt and pepper.
  3. Step 3
    Sauté chicken in oil and butter until cooked. Remove and set aside.
  4. Step 4
    In the same pan, sauté garlic for 30 seconds.
  5. Step 5
    Add broth, cream, honey, soy sauce, and pepper flakes. Simmer until thickened.
  6. Step 6
    Return chicken, stir to coat.
  7. Step 7
    Add Parmesan, mix until creamy.
  8. Step 8
    Add pasta, toss everything together.
  9. Step 9
    Garnish with parsley and extra cheese. Serve hot!
